> I'm having problems with accented characters in strings.
> 
> Pieces of soft I used is :
> + mod-wsgi 4.5.20 and 4.5.21
> + Python 3.5.2
> + Django 1.8.18 and 1.11.7
> + Apache2 2.4.18
> + Ubuntu 16.04
> 
> 
> The following code in a view doesn't output to the logfile the line with 
> accented characters :
> 
> ~~~ python
> import logging
> 
> from django.shortcuts import render, render_to_response
> 
> def home(request):
>     debug_logger = logging.getLogger("debug")
>     debug_logger.debug('haha')  # this works
>     debug_logger.debug('héhé')  # this is missing !?!
>     debug_logger.debug('huhu')  # this works
>     return render_to_response('home.html', {})
> ~~~
> 
> On the other hand, when I run the same code by hand within :
> 
> $ python manage.py shell
> 
> everything appears in the log file.
> 
> 
> I'm not sure what could be the problem, but since the behaviour is different 
> when launched in Apache/mod-wsgi context than by hand (in Python or in 
> iPython), I guess something has to be elucidate around here.
> 
> Apache's config is the following :
> 
> ~~~
> WSGIDaemonProcess main processes=1 threads=15 
> python-home=/django_app/venv/py3 python-path=/django_app/foo1 
> display-name=%{GROUP}
> WSGIScriptAlias / /django_app/foo1/foo1/wsgi.py
> WSGIApplicationGroup %{GLOBAL}
> WSGIProcessGroup main
> 
> Alias /static/ /django_app/foo1/static/
> 
> <Directory /django_app/foo1/static>
>     Options -Indexes
>     <IfVersion < 2.3>
>         Order deny,allow
>         Allow from all
>     </IfVersion>
>     <IfVersion >= 2.3>
>         Require all granted
>     </IfVersion>
> </Directory>
> 
> <Directory /django_app/foo1/foo1>
>     <Files wsgi.py>
>         <IfVersion < 2.3>
>             Order deny,allow
>             Allow from all
>         </IfVersion>
>         <IfVersion >= 2.3>
>             Require all granted
>         </IfVersion>
>     </Files>
> </Directory>
> ~~~
> 
> and 
> 
> ~~~
> WSGIRestrictEmbedded On
> ~~~
